Output 2fbb578593c90f7a8269920ab69620b80aa012ffb082cc5fa06dcd115d738907:1
- value
- 19782320
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 dca5cb32689842322040acbdd987a90d32defd21 OP_EQUAL
- address
- 3MohCJCQ62sVfX5KbQjiX2vbgLJqDH3i8q
- transaction
- 2fbb578593c90f7a8269920ab69620b80aa012ffb082cc5fa06dcd115d738907
- spent
- true